Atlas Taps Kirby Sr. VP
NEW YORK — Atlas Media, one of the busiest producers of nonfiction programming in the U.S., has hired Kaki Kirby as senior VP of business development and special projects, a newly created post.
Kirby, formerly senior VP of Foxstar Prods., the reality-show unit of Fox TV Studios, will take on responsibility not only for development but for sales and marketing as well. She’ll report directly to Bruce David Klein, president and executive producer of Gotham-based Atlas.
Churning out more than 150 hours of programming annually, Atlas Media engineered an expansion of the company’s operations earlier this year, promoting Steve Friedman to senior VP of production and setting up a new division dedicated to home and lifestyle shows under the aegis of exec VP of programming Maria Lane.
Among Atlas’ current successes are “Breaking Vegas” on the History Channel, “Dr. G: Medical Examiner” on Discovery Health and “All Year Round With Katie Brown” on A&E.
Atlas is in production on upcoming Food Network series “Behind the Bash.” Giada De Laurentiis hosts the weekly show that details how party planners and catering companies put together a big event.
At Foxstar, Kirby supervised a staff of about 150 who produced shows for Fox Family, AMC, the History Channel, A&E, Travel Channel and National Geographic Channel.
